Transponder keys

It is crucial to replace your transponder keys in the event that you have lost them. This will require an expert locksmith. These keys are well-known among locksmiths, who can program a new one.

Transponder keys are one type of car key with an electronic chip in it. The chip transmits a message to the computer in the car. Without this signal the vehicle won't start.

Transponder keys are more secure than a traditional mechanical key. It also makes it more difficult to steal. The ignition lock cannot be hot-wired by thieves , and it won't even be copied.

Before the advent of the transponder system for keys, thieves could steal your car, then drive away in minutes. The car won't begin until it receives an unintentional signal from its key.

In addition to making it difficult for thieves to gain access to your vehicle, transponder keys can aid in recovering your vehicle in the event that it gets stolen. They can also be used to replace lost or damaged keys.

The cost to replace your transponder keys varies based on the make and type of the vehicle. A new key will usually cost more than a traditional one. This is due to the fact that the new key must be programmed to the vehicle.

Based on your requirements it is possible that you will require an additional battery for your transponder key. Some batteries last for quite a while. Others require replacement frequently.

In the past, it was easy and affordable to replace a transponder core. However, now it's a lengthy process. It is recommended to employ an experienced locksmith. Since they are expensive and inconvenient automobile dealerships aren't the best options to acquire transponder keys.

Smart keys

Smart keys for cars can be very useful for a variety of reasons. Smart keys for automobiles make it possible to lock and unlock your vehicle from a distance with no requirement of carrying keys that are traditional. Based on the car you drive you may also have the ability to start your engine without a key.

You can either purchase an updated smart-key for your vehicle from the dealership or purchase one from a third party. Both choices have pros and cons. It is recommended to purchase an alternate key from a dealer.

When you're buying a smart key for a car, you should choose one that's appropriate for your particular model. You should avoid pre-programmed keys. The majority of manufacturers won't allow you to purchase a smart key directly from them.

A locksmith is another alternative. A professional locksmith can reprogram your chip key and open your car. Alternately, you can contact a mobile locksmith auto locksmith to help you out.

The most important thing to remember when using a smart key is to keep it out of harm's reach. This means keeping it away from sharp objects and hard surfaces. Also, ensure that your key is within a particular range. The typical range is between 100-150 feet.

Smart keys for cars are extremely convenient, but they can also be risky. You might not be able unlock your car if you misplace your key. Your vehicle could end up in a garage, or in a parking lot if your key is not returned. It's crucial to have a replacement key in case you misplace yours.
